In this gripping episode of Clean and Sober Radio, host Gary Hendler and co-host Mark Sigmund sit down with Nolen Burchett, who candidly shares his journey from opioid addiction to bank robbery, and ultimately, to a life of recovery and purpose. Nolen opens up about the desperate choices that led him to rob three banks in a single month and the harrowing experience of being shot by deputies during his arrest.
Despite these challenges, Nolen's story is one of resilience and redemption. After serving over five years in prison, Nolen found a new path by working in addiction recovery at Touchstone Recovery Center. His work now involves helping others find their way out of addiction, employing many who are also in recovery.
